3. Enjoy Timber Without the Upkeep
Natural timber is beautiful, but for many, it's also intimidating. Some tables are finished with a thick plastic finish which is more durable but doesn’t age well , as it leaves watermarks, heat rings, and scratches in the plastic layer. That's why we’ve designed our table to let you enjoy the timber feel with a beautiful oil finish which ages well.
The rotating top allows you to preserve one side for special occasions, while the other side can handle the everyday hustle.
